Prism refracting white light C018 / 8603

A glass prism demonstrating internal refractions of white light into the colour spectrum. This splitting of light into the spectrum is a result of the different amounts of refraction of the different wavelengths of light present. Furthermore each colour is specific to the angle that the prisms faces present to the light
